In Gonubie, Eastern Cape, solar energy equipment suppliers play a pivotal role in helping households and small businesses transition to renewable power. The typical offering centres on a comprehensive pathway from initial assessment to ongoing maintenance, with emphasis on practicality for coastal and regional conditions. Customers can expect a consultative approach that considers energy needs, roof or site suitability, and local climate when proposing solar solutions.
Initial consultations commonly involve a site visit or remote assessment to understand electricity consumption patterns, available space for installation, and potential shading from nearby structures or trees. From this information, suppliers present a customised concept that outlines the proposed photovoltaic (PV) system, suggested inverters, mounting hardware, batteries for storage where appropriate, and the required electrical components. The aim is to balance performance, reliability, and cost within the context of the Eastern Cape climate, where high sun exposure and variable weather influence system design.
Another core service is detailed system design and technical specification. This includes sizing the PV array to meet prevailing demand, selecting compatible inverters and, for storage-led setups, battery technologies and capacities. Where applicable, recommendations address hybrid configurations that combine grid electricity with solar power, as well as off-grid arrangements for remote properties. The design phase may also consider future expansion, such as adding more panels or enhanced storage as energy needs grow or tariffs evolve.
Procurement and installation are typically coordinated through the supplier, which may source modules, inverters, batteries, mounting racking, and electrical accessories from reputable manufacturers. On receipt of components, qualified technicians arrange delivery to the site and oversee professional installation. This stage covers electrical connections, roof or ground mounting, cabling routes, and safety measures to ensure compliance with local electrical standards and building regulations. In many cases, coordination includes liaising with electricity distributors or municipalities regarding permits, metering, and any required inspections.
Post-installation support forms a significant part of the offering. Customers can expect commissioning and performance verification to confirm that the system operates as designed. Training or written guidance on basic operation, monitoring dashboards, and how to respond to daytime or seasonal performance changes is commonly provided. Maintenance services may be offered as part of a service plan, including periodic inspections, cleaning of modules, and component checks to sustain system efficiency and extend asset life.
- Grid-tied systems that feed surplus electricity back into the local network, with considerations for feed-in arrangements and net metering where available.
- Hybrid systems that blend solar generation with existing electricity supply and battery storage to improve reliability during outages or high-demand periods.
- Off-grid setups designed for remote properties, prioritising autonomy, battery capacity, and resilience in the face of weather variability.
Practical considerations for choosing a solar energy supplier in Gonubie include the suitability of roof or land area, orientation and shading, local weather patterns, and budget considerations. It is prudent to discuss warranties, expected lifespan of components, and what maintenance responsibilities fall to the owner versus the supplier. Additionally, guidance on financing options, insurances, and potential tax or regional incentives may be offered to assist in making an informed, long-term investment.
